Appeals having been taken from orders of the Supreme Court, New York County, entered on or about October 7, 2016 and
October 18, 2016, and said appeals having been perfected, And defendant-respondent having moved for an extension of time to file a respondent's brief (M-6479), And plaintiff-appellant having cross-moved for a preference in hearing of the appeal, and for an expedited decision with respect to said appeal (M-6480), Now, upon reading and filing the papers with respect to the motion and cross motion, and due deliberation having been had thereon,It is ordered that the motion is granted to the extent of adjourning the perfected appeal to the April 2018 Term, with no further adjournments to be granted. The Clerk is directed to calendar the appeal for hearing in the first week of said April 2018 Term. ENTERED: January 9, 2018
